epuration

English dictionary entry

Meanings

noun
  1. purification of a product (such as in the process of sugar extraction)
  2. any type of political cleansing, such as ethnic cleansing

Word forms

epuration epurations

Etymology

From French épuration.

This entry uses open data from Wiktionary (CC BY-SA/GFDL). Word forms are used for search and are not indexed as separate pages.